Decoding the Date Type: From Casual Coffee to Candlelit Dinners
Dates come in flavors, and your clothing should match the taste. A casual coffee or a walk in the park screams for something relaxed but put-together – think clean sneakers, dark wash jeans, and a well-fitting t-shirt or a simple button-down. A dinner date allows for a bit more polish. Maybe chinos, a crisp button-down, and a sharp casual jacket or blazer. Heading to a bar? Dark jeans and a clean, stylish shirt usually do the trick. The key is to avoid looking like you just rolled out of bed or, conversely, like you're trying way too hard for a casual setting. It's about hitting the right note.
- Casual Coffee/Walk: Dark jeans, clean sneakers, simple t-shirt or casual button-down.
- Dinner Date (Mid-Range): Chinos or dark jeans, button-down shirt, possibly a blazer or sharp jacket.
- Dinner Date (Fancy): Trousers, dress shirt, blazer or suit jacket, dress shoes.
- Bar/Drinks: Dark jeans, stylish shirt (maybe a subtle pattern), clean casual shoes or boots.
- Activity Date (Bowling, Mini-Golf): Comfortable, clean jeans or chinos, t-shirt or casual shirt, appropriate footwear (not your beat-up gym shoes).

Seasonal Date Night Outfit Ideas for Guys: Dressing for the Weather

Seasonal Date Night Outfit Ideas for Guys: Dressing for the Weather
Spring and Summer: Keep it Cool, Literally
the sun's out, the weather's cooperating, and you're not battling frostbite. This is prime time for easier dressing. Think lighter fabrics – cotton, linen blends. For spring date night outfit ideas for guys, a simple, well-fitting t-shirt or a short-sleeve button-down in a solid color or subtle pattern works great. Pair it with chinos or even clean, non-distressed jeans. Summer? Linen shirts are your friend. They breathe. Nobody wants to be a sweaty mess five minutes into a date. Avoid heavy fabrics or anything too clingy. It's about looking relaxed but intentional.
Fall: Layer Up Without Looking Like a Puffer Fish
Ah, fall. The golden child of men's fashion seasons. Layers are your superpower here, but use them wisely. Start with a solid base – a t-shirt or a thin sweater. Add a layer like a denim jacket, a bomber jacket, or a sharp chore coat. A casual blazer over a henley or a fine-gauge sweater also hits the mark for fall date night outfit ideas for guys. Corduroy pants or darker wash jeans fit the vibe perfectly. The key is layers you can actually remove if the temperature shifts or you end up somewhere warmer inside. Don't get trapped in a thermal straitjacket.
Season | Key Items | Avoid |
---|---|---|
Spring/Summer | Linen shirts, cotton tees, chinos, light jackets | Heavy wool, thick sweaters, anything non-breathable |
Fall | Light sweaters, denim/bomber/chore jackets, corduroy, dark jeans | Bulky parkas (unless necessary), too many heavy layers |
Winter | Wool sweaters, flannel shirts, heavier coats, boots | Lightweight fabrics, thin socks, open-toed shoes (obviously) |
Winter: Staying Warm While Still Looking Like You Tried
Winter throws a wrench into things. Your primary goal is not freezing, but you don't have to sacrifice style entirely. Wool sweaters are your best friend – a chunky knit or a fine merino depending on the date's formality. Layering is essential. A thermal layer under a flannel shirt and a sweater works. Outerwear matters. A sharp wool coat instantly elevates even simple jeans and a sweater. A clean, technical parka is fine for more casual outings. Footwear becomes crucial too; boots are practical and can look great. Think about texture – corduroy, flannel, heavier denim. The best winter date night outfit ideas for guys balance warmth with looking put-together, not like you're about to climb Everest.
YearRound Date Night Outfit Ideas for Guys: Staples That Always Work

YearRound Date Night Outfit Ideas for Guys: Staples That Always Work
Staples That Never Go Out of Style
Look, trends come and go faster than your enthusiasm for online dating. But some things just work, year after year, season after season. These are the bedrock of solid date night outfit ideas for guys. We're talking about the reliable players in your closet. A great pair of dark wash jeans, maybe without any rips or fake fading – they're versatile enough for a casual bar or a slightly nicer dinner when paired correctly. Chinos in classic colors like navy, olive, or khaki are another absolute must-have; they instantly look a bit more polished than denim but are still comfortable. Then there are the shirts: a crisp white or light blue button-down, a simple but well-fitting crewneck sweater in a neutral color, or even a dark, plain t-shirt made of decent material. Finally, a versatile jacket or blazer – something unstructured and easy to wear over a shirt or sweater – pulls a lot of looks together and elevates them instantly. These pieces are the foundation, allowing you to build countless year-round date night outfits for guys without needing a massive wardrobe.
Beyond the Basics: Shoes, Accessories, and Fit for Your Date Night Outfit

Beyond the Basics: Shoes, Accessories, and Fit for Your Date Night Outfit
The Details Matter: Shoes, Accessories, and Getting the Fit Right
you've got the main pieces sorted – the shirt, the pants, maybe a jacket. Great start. But honestly, the difference between looking *good* and looking like you actually know what you're doing often comes down to the details. We're talking about your shoes. Scuffed-up trainers with nice chinos? No. Worn-out boots with a blazer? Also no. Your footwear needs to match the vibe and be clean. Accessories aren't mandatory for every date night outfit ideas for guys scenario, but a decent watch, a simple leather belt that matches your shoes, or even a pocket square for a dressier occasion can subtly elevate the whole look. And fit? This is non-negotiable. A shirt that's too baggy makes you look sloppy; pants that are too tight are just uncomfortable and distracting. Spend a little time making sure things fit reasonably well. It makes a world of difference.
Think about it: you could be wearing the perfect combination of shirt and pants, but if your shoes look like you wrestled a bear in them, or your belt looks like something you found in a dumpster, the whole thing falls apart. These smaller elements are the finishing touches that show you paid attention. They communicate care and effort without you having to say a word. It’s the sartorial equivalent of remembering their coffee order – small detail, big impact.
Quick Check: Are Your Details Dialed In?
- Are your shoes clean and appropriate for the date's location?
- Does your belt match your shoes (if you're wearing one)?
- Is your watch (if you wear one) clean and functional?
- Do your clothes fit comfortably without being too tight or too loose?
